I kinda do and don’t miss my ROD-10. I think it was OD-III that was surprising close to the VH brown sound thing and the Distortion mode vibed for me better than the DS-1 type stuff I played. The limited switching and pedal-level rack configuration just didn’t quite fit for my use. I have had thoughts of using the sub circuits to inspire DIY—the discrete circuit variants were a precursor to things like the BD-2.

I didn’t dig the fuzz, though. I found it a bit polite and clear for its Super Fuzz lineage, though I can see it being desirable for that specific sitar thing.

i used to own an Elk Fuzz Wau which had the Ibanez stand fuzz for the fuzz section of the circuit. Pretty distinct sound.. kinda like a orange and blue superfuzz with the octave turned down halfway.. massive sounding in both EQ settings.

I just looked up the Ibanez Standard Fuzz and the Kay Fuzz on Reverb. There's a $500 Standard Fuzz and the listing says that Dan Auerbach uses it (also a couple of $500 Wau pedals).

The Kay Fuzz was cloned by JHS for the Legends of Fuzz series and the cheapest one is like $150 (used).

Sounds like a cool circuit, I'd like to see a indie builder make a clone.
